Ezekiel 33

Studie

   

1 And the word of Jehovah was unto me, saying,

2 Son of man, speak to the sons of thy people, and say to them, When I bring the sword upon a land, and the people of the land take one man from within their ends, and put him for a watchman for them;

3 and he sees the sword come on the land, and he sounds the shophar*, and warns the people;

4 and the hearer hear the voice of the shophar, and take· not ·warning, and the sword come, and take him, his blood shall be on his own head.

5 He heard the voice of the shophar, and took· not ·warning; his blood shall be upon him. But he who takes·​·warning shall deliver his soul.

6 But if the watchman should see the sword coming, and not sound the shophar, and the people be not warned; and the sword come, and take a soul from among them, he is taken in his iniquity, but his blood will I require from the hand of the watchman.

7 And thou, O son of man, I have set thee a watchman to the house of Israel; and thou shalt hear the word from My mouth, and warn them from Me.

8 When I say to the wicked, O wicked one, dying thou shalt die; if thou dost not speak to warn the wicked from his way, that wicked one shall die in his iniquity; but his blood will I seek at thy hand.

9 But thou, if thou warn the wicked of his way to turn·​·back from it, and he does not turn·​·back from his way, he shall·​·die in his iniquity; but thou hast rescued thy soul.

10 And thou, son of man, say to the house of Israel, Thus you say, saying, Surely our transgressions and our sins be upon us, and we waste·​·away in them, and how should we live?

11 Say to them, As I am alive, says the Lord Jehovih*, I have no delight in the death of the wicked, but that the wicked turn·​·back from his way and live; turn· ye ·back, turn· ye ·back from your evil ways; for why will you die, O house of Israel?

12 And thou, son of man, say to the sons of thy people, The justice of the just shall not rescue him in the day of his transgression; and the wickedness of the wicked, he shall not stumble on it in the day that he turns·​·back from his wickedness; neither shall the just be·​·able to live in his justice in the day of his sin.

13 When I shall say to the just, that living he shall live, and he should trust upon his own justice, and do perversity, all his justice shall not be remembered; but for his perversity that he has done, he shall·​·die for it.

14 And when I say to the wicked, Dying thou shalt die, and he turn·​·back from his sin, and do judgment and justice,

15 If the wicked return the pledge, repay what·​·is·​·robbed, walk in the statutes of life, without doing perversity, living he shall live; he shall· not ·die.

16 All of his sins that he has sinned shall not be mentioned to him; he has done judgment and justice; living he shall live.

17 But the sons of thy people say, The way of the Lord is· not ·fair*; but as for them, their way is· not ·fair.

18 When the just turns·​·back from his justice, and does perversity, he shall· even ·die thereby.

19 But if the wicked turn·​·back from his wickedness, and do judgment and justice, thereby he shall live.

20 But you say, The way of the Lord is· not ·fair. O ye house of Israel, I will judge you, each·​·man according·​·to his ways.

21 And it was, in the twelfth year of our exile, in the tenth month, in the fifth of the month, that one who had escaped from Jerusalem came to me, saying, The city is smitten.

22 And the hand of Jehovah was upon me in the evening, before the coming of him who escaped; and He opened my mouth, until he came to me in the morning; and my mouth was opened, and I was·​·dumb no more.

23 And the word of Jehovah was to me, saying,

24 Son of man, they who dwell·​·in these wastes of the ground of Israel say, saying, Abraham was one, and he possessed the land, but we are many; the land is given to us for a possession.

25 Therefore say to them, Thus says the Lord Jehovih: You eat with the blood, and lift your eyes to your idols, and shed blood; and shall you possess the land?

26 You stand upon your sword, you do abomination, and you are defiled, a man with the wife of his companion; and shall you possess the land?

27 Say thou thus to them, Thus says the Lord Jehovih: As I live, surely they who are in the wastes shall fall by the sword, and him who is on the faces of the field will I give to the wild·​·animals to devour, and they that be in the forts and in the caves shall die of the pestilence.

28 And I will lay the land most desolate, and the pride of her strength shall cease; and the mountains of Israel shall be desolate, that none shall pass·​·through.

29 And they shall know that I am Jehovah, when I have laid the land most desolate on·​·account·​·of all their abominations which they have done.

30 And thou, son of man, the sons of thy people are speaking against thee beside the walls and in the entrances of the houses, and they speak one with another one, a man to his brother, saying, Come, I pray you, and hear what the word is that goes·​·forth from Jehovah.

31 And they come unto thee as the coming of a people, and they sit before thee as My people, and they hear thy words, but they will not do them; for with their mouth they do dote, but their heart goes after their own gain.

32 And, behold, thou art to them as a doting song of a beautiful voice, and thou strummest well; and they hear thy words, but none of them do them.

33 And when it comes—, behold it comes—then they shall know that a prophet has been among them.
